    Hayots Ashkharh Daily, Armenia
    Nov 3 2007


    WE SHOULDN'T LOOK FOR THE ROOT OF THE EVIL IN KARABAKH


    Recently Ter-Petrosyan `brought his regular pleasant surprise' to
    the native society, and made Raffi Hovhannisyan happy by promising the
    latter to visit the central office of `Heritage' party.
    `Does this mean that `Heritage' activists are ready to participate
    in the initiative of nominating the ex-President as pro-opposition
    united candidate?'
    In response to our question Secretary of NA `Heritage' faction,
    Stepan Safaryan shrugged his shoulders and said, 'The party hasn't
    discussed such issue.'
    How did he evaluate Levon Ter-Petrosyan's speech delivered during
    October 26 demonstration? It turned out that Mr. Safaryan had just
    returned from Tehran where he didn't have access to the Internet and
    didn't manage to familiarize himself with the epochal speech of the
    ex-President.
    After being informed from us that ex-President appeared in the
    opening of the demonstration season with a `white tailcoat', with
    absolutely no hint about the numerous temptations faced by the people
    during his sensitive years of power, calling the government in power
    `pro-Kocharyan criminal administration', no more no less than a `state
    of chieftains and plunderers'. Our interlocutor asked with
    astonishment `Did he really say that?' And added, `If the conversation
    is about normal political process, naturally both sides must give
    detailed explanation not regarding the past but also the current
    processes.'
    `Anyhow, how does the member of the political power that came out
    with an initiative on `Armenia's recognition of NKR' evaluate Levon
    Ter-Petrosyan's concept of the regulation of Karabakh issue?'
    `I don't think Levon Ter-Petrosyan came out with his approaches on
    the regulation of Karabakh issue. I haven't seen it yet,' the
    Secretary of `Heritage' faction diplomatically recorded.
    By announcing in his speech in `Armenia-Marriott' that Karabakh
    issue needs swift `solution', otherwise Armenia won't have future and
    that day-by-day Azerbaijan makes its attitude tougher and that it will
    never agree to mutual concessions, didn't Levon Ter-Petrosyan
    reconfirm his capitulatory attitudes of 1997? Doesn't this mean that
    the root of all our problems that is to say the evil is Karabakh?
    `I don't agree that Karabakh is the reason of our bad life. I would
    agree to this concept had we conducted effective governance during the
    previous years and came to a conclusion that it is not enough. Of
    course no one can refuse that the failure to regulate Karabakh issue
    hinders the country's development but this doesn't mean that NKR
    conflict is to blame for all the problems faced by the country,'
    S. Safaryan underscored in response to our question.
    In his accusations addressed to the `administration' Levon
    Ter-Petrosyan didn't forget to mention about the abrupt economic
    growth recorded by Azerbaijan during the recent years, as compared to
    which Armenia's 12% annual economic growth `is nothing'. Does this
    mean that it is the fault of `pro-Kocharyan administration' that
    Azerbaijan has oil, but Armenia unfortunately lacks oil resources.
    According to our interlocutor ex-President didn't make a revelation
    by saying this, `Of course in comparison, in terms of financial and
    economic means Azerbaijan's progress is logical. In my view the issue
    is on quite another plane - from the point of view of security to what
    extent are we interrelated to the European security system are we able
    to neutralize the danger? Here we have real slip-ups.

    S. HARUTYUNYAN
